CVE-2025-59347 Dragonfly Manager makes requests to external endpoints with disabled TLS authentication
Dragonfly is an open source P2P-based file distribution and image acceleration system. Prior to 2.1.0, The Manager disables TLS certificate verification in HTTP clients. GHSA-89VC-VF32-CH59 Dragonfly doesn't have authentication enabled for some Manager’s endpoints
Impact The /api/v1/jobs and /preheats endpoints in Manager web UI are accessible without authentication.
